Transaction e32c76458658d97cc1835488837f625edf7e98d2ff7437e6f2a0fb524082437a
1 Input
2 Outputs
- e32c76458658d97cc1835488837f625edf7e98d2ff7437e6f2a0fb524082437a:0
- e32c76458658d97cc1835488837f625edf7e98d2ff7437e6f2a0fb524082437a:1
value 95319000
address 3KoAsfhtznA33GcQ4dfGajkr6xj8NC93c3
value 1424906
address 1Aka6y2RjNqHbvNYMSeV2GgZuXZbBX4r2U